I just finished a delicious lunch at Liuzza's By The Track. They finally had the shrimp stew which I adore. Much better than their gumbo. You can tell the two dishes are very distant cousins with the tomato base and the shrimp puffed out yet not overly done. The flavors are deep in the shrimp stew but yet still muted. The spice sneaks up on you. It doesn't hit you over the head like the it does with their gumbo.

The base of the shrimp stew isn't as brothy. It's thicker and more rounded. Both dishes come served over a bed of rice but while the gumbo is a busy firebrand of heat and energy, the shrimp stew is a more elegant delicately composed dish that in it's simplicity reflects a more seriousness of purpose than the too cool for school gumbo.
